Game Recap: Women's Ice Hockey | | Evelyn Klein, Athletics Communications Assistant

No. 15 Cardinals blank Bears

POTSDAM, N.Y. – The SUNY Potsdam women's hockey team (8-9-2, 3-4-1) was blanked by No. 15 Plattsburgh State (12-6-0, 7-1-0) 5-0 on Saturday afternoon at Maxcy Ice Arena. 

HOW IT HAPPENED
  • The Cardinals had a trio of goals in the opening period, with the first coming at 2:25, scored by junior forward Sydnee Francis (Canton, N.Y./Nepean Jr. Wildcats) and assisted by sophomore forward Kate Conlon (New Hudson, Mich./Little Caesars). 
  • Plattsburgh doubled its lead three minutes later through sophomore forward Tessa Morris (Grand Island, N.Y./Rome Girl's hockey). Francis and senior defenseman Su-an Cho (Madison, Ala./Florida Alliance) had the assists. 
  • Freshman forward Zoe Puc (West Palm Beach, Fla./Florida Alliance) netted the third for the Cardinals with one second left in the period, assisted by junior forward Emily Kasprzak (Niagara Falls, N.Y./Pittsburgh Penguins Elite) and junior defenseman Maeghan Forsyth (Billings, Mont./Notre Dame Hounds). 
  • Senior Bears' goaltender Magalie Parent (Trois-Rivières, Quebec/Les Diablos – Cégep de Trois-Rivières) made 12 saves in the first period. 
  • Plattsburgh added two more in the second period. 
  • Puc got her second of the night, assisted by senior forward Molly Riggi (Farmingdale, N.J./New Jersey Titans) and freshman forward Riley Keller (Cuba, N.Y./Nichols School) at 4:08. 
  • Sophomore forward Brooke Terry (Massena, N.Y./Nazareth University) made it 5-0 for the Cardinals at the end of the second. Freshman defenseman Lauren Farris (Northville, Mich./Belle Tire) and Kasprzak picked up the assists. 
  • Potsdam sophomore goaltender Maddy Ferguson (Medicine Hat, Alberta/S. Alberta Hockey Academy) made 11 saves to keep the third period scoreless. 

INSIDE THE NUMBERS 
  • The Bears were outshot 30 to 14. 
  • Both teams were 0-for-4 on the power play. 
  • Parent stopped 13 shots and allowed five goals in 37:40. Ferguson made 12 saves, allowing no goals in 22:20. 
  • Plattsburgh sophomore goaltender Maddy Stetson (Wasilla, Alaska/Little Caesars) turned aside 14 shots in the contest.
